This is my first posting here and I am new to aspnet so be patient. I
am using a DataGrid with sorted columns to display some research data.
The data is bound to the DataGrid from a xml file and a schema file.
The row count can be anywhere from 600 to several thousand. If I
disable paging and sort a couple of columns, all my "Back" history is
lost and I can't click the Back button more than once. If I enable
paging and set the page size to 500 rows, I get the same behavior.
However, if I set the page size to 250 rows, then navigation is as it
should be. I can sort multiple times on different columns and still
cycle back through them and get back to a reports page, etc.
Has anyone else experienced this? Is there a solution or workaround?
